Some considerations regarding the 20 v 12 question.
Yes for deer hunting, given a good & proper shot to the vitals, either will cleanly dispatch a deer.
However there is no guarantee of perfection. Sometimes a shot goes a little low, a little high, a little forward or a little back. And that is where it may be good to consider the answer to this.
If you were to be "run thru" in an area of your body, not directly thru a vital, but maybe pretty close, would you rather have it be with a .615" (20 gauge) round shank or a .729" (12 gauge) round shank?
